
A playful exchange unfolded on Twitter earlier today between a popular Nigerian comedian, Lasisi Elenu, and a Twitter user known as ‘Olu the dust bankole.’ The conversation, sparked by a tweet from ‘Olu the dust bankole,’ had the internet in stitches as both parties exchanged humorous comments about a viral video.
‘Olu the dust bankole,’ in his tweet, humorously criticized Lasisi Elenu for no longer including links to his videos, writing, “You don grow wing now, you no dey add link to the video again abi 😂.”
In typical Lasisi Elenu fashion, the comedian responded with his signature wit. He reposted the comment, offering a light-hearted reply: “Forgive us sir. If I may… Here is the link to the video my lord. Enjoy it, may Ogun no kee your papa 😜.”
The tweet, which included a link to the video in question (youtu.be/_Xy1_heegBU), quickly gained attention from fans, who found the exchange both entertaining and relatable.
Lasisi Elenu, known for his viral comedic skits, has built a large online following, regularly sharing videos and engaging with fans. His sense of humor, combined with his playful interactions on social media, continues to make him a fan favorite in the Nigerian entertainment scene.
The light-hearted back-and-forth between Lasisi and ‘Olu the dust bankole’ serves as another reminder of the playful side of Nigerian social media culture, where humor often takes center stage, even in the most casual exchanges.
